Hornby Railways is a British model railway brand. Its roots date back to 1901, when its founder Frank Hornby received a patent for his Meccano construction toy.
What's the font used for Hornby Railways logo?
The font used for Hornby Railways logo is ITC Lubalin Graph Bold, which is a geometric slab serif font designed by Edward Benguiat & Herb Lubalin and published by ITC.
